The Neuroscience of Thermal Sensation: Why Temperature Play Works

Understanding how the nervous system processes temperature sensation explains directly why temperature variation amplifies arousal and why certain approaches to temperature play produce stronger responses than others.

How Thermoreceptors Amplify Arousal

The skin contains two distinct categories of thermoreceptors: warm receptors (responding to temperatures above approximately 30°C/86°F) and cold receptors (responding to temperatures below approximately 35°C/95°F). Both types are distributed across the skin with particularly high density in the genitals, inner thighs, perineum, nipples, and other erogenous areas.

These thermoreceptors do not simply register temperature they interact directly with arousal pathways in the nervous system. Warm stimulation activates some of the same nerve fiber types as light touch, which is why warming an intimate product to body temperature or slightly above produces sensation that feels more intimate and more skin-like than room-temperature material. Cold stimulation activates different thermoreceptor types that produce a sharp, attention-focusing sensation that can heighten sensitivity to subsequent touch.

The most neurologically significant temperature play technique is contrast alternating between warm and cool stimulation. The sudden shift from warm to cool (or vice versa) produces a more intense sensory response than either temperature sustained alone, because thermoreceptors respond most strongly to change rather than to sustained constant temperature. This is why temperature play that incorporates contrast consistently produces stronger arousal amplification than warming alone.

The Difference Between Warmth and Heat: The Safety Line

The most important distinction in temperature play safety is between warmth and heat. Warmth temperatures between body temperature (37°C/98.6°F) and approximately 42°C/107.6°F produces pleasurable thermal sensation, amplifies arousal, and supports psychological intimate engagement without causing tissue damage. Heat temperatures above approximately 43°C/109.4°F against skin begins to activate pain receptors rather than thermoreceptors and can cause burns with sustained contact.

Genital tissue, particularly vaginal and anal mucosa, is more sensitive to temperature than external skin. The safe upper limit for internal temperature play is lower than for external use approximately 40°C/104°F against mucosa versus 42°C/107.6°F against external skin. Any product intended for internal temperature play must be tested on the inner wrist or forearm areas with temperature sensitivity closer to genital mucosa than the palm before internal use.

For cold play: the safe lower limit for genital contact is approximately 10°C/50°F for external use and 15°C/59°F for internal use. Temperatures below this range risk tissue injury from cold, particularly with prolonged contact. Ice applied directly to genital mucosa without a barrier carries genuine injury risk and is not appropriate for internal use.

Temperature Play Methods: How to Warm and Cool Platinum Silicone Safely

Warming Methods for Platinum Silicone Products

Warm water immersion the safest and most effective method: Submerge the insertable portion of the toy in warm (not hot) water for 5 to 10 minutes before use. Water at 40°C/104°F comfortably warm on the wrist, not scalding produces excellent thermal results. The platinum silicone will reach approximately the water temperature after sufficient immersion. Test on the inner wrist before any body contact.

The warm water method is safe because: platinum silicone can only reach the water's temperature (not exceed it), the gradual temperature transfer makes hot spots impossible, and the test on the wrist before use provides a reliable safety check.

Body warmth during arousal: Platinum silicone warms naturally with sustained body contact. Holding a toy in your hands or against body warmth during an arousal warm-up period produces gradual, natural body-temperature warming that feels more organic than water warming and is entirely self-regulating. This is the approach implicitly used every time a warming session begins with the toy held during foreplay, and produces the characteristic "warms to body temperature" quality that platinum silicone is known for.

Warming pad or towel warm-up: A heating pad set to low, or a warm towel from a recent warm-water wash, can be wrapped around the toy for 5 to 10 minutes. Use a thermometer to confirm the surface temperature is below 42°C/107.6°F before testing on the wrist.

Methods to avoid: Microwave warming of any intimate product creates uneven, impossible-to-control heating that produces hot spots. Boiling water produces temperatures (100°C/212°F) far exceeding safe ranges boiling is for sterilization after anal use, not warming for temperature play. Electric heating elements or direct heat sources produce uncontrolled temperatures.

Cooling Methods for Platinum Silicone Products

Refrigerator cooling the safest cold play method: Place the toy in the refrigerator (not freezer) for 20 to 30 minutes before use. Standard refrigerators maintain 3°C to 5°C/37°F to 41°F at the lower range of what is appropriate for external use but cooler than the 15°C/59°F minimum for internal use. Allow the toy to warm slightly at room temperature for a few minutes to bring it to approximately 10°C to 15°C/50°F to 59°F before use, and test on the inner wrist before body contact.

Cool water immersion: Submerge in cool (not ice cold) water for 5 to 10 minutes a method that produces moderate cooling without approaching dangerous cold ranges. Water temperature of approximately 15°C to 20°C/59°F to 68°F produces noticeable cold sensation while remaining safely above tissue-injury thresholds.

Freeze methods to avoid for internal use: Freezer temperatures (-18°C/0°F and below) produce products far below the safe internal contact range. Toys intended for internal use should never be used directly from the freezer.

Temperature Play Technique: Maximizing Sensation Safety and Intensity

The Contrast Technique: Maximum Arousal Amplification

The most arousal-amplifying temperature play approach uses contrast alternating between warmed and cooled stimulation to exploit the nervous system's heightened response to temperature change.

Practical contrast sequence for solo temperature play:

Step 1: Spend 5 to 10 minutes on external warming holding the warmed dildo against external erogenous areas (inner thighs, perineum, lower abdomen) while establishing external arousal through other means. The warmth initiates arousal; external stimulation builds it.

Step 2: Apply a cooled external object cool water-soaked cloth, briefly refrigerated smooth object held externally to the perineum or inner thighs. The sudden temperature shift from warm to cool produces the sharp sensory response that thermoreceptors respond most strongly to.

Step 3: Return to warmed internal stimulation. After cool external exposure, warmed internal contact feels significantly more intense than it would have without the contrast the thermoreceptors have been sensitized by the contrast.

Step 4: Maintain slow, deliberate internal technique at consistent warm temperature. The contrast has amplified sensitivity; sustained warm contact now builds arousal progressively rather than plateauing.

The Arousal-First Principle for Temperature Play

Full sexual arousal before any internal temperature play contact changes the experience significantly. During full arousal, genital blood flow increases substantially which means the temperature differential between warmed material and engorged tissue is experienced more vividly. Cold play applied to unaroused tissue produces a sharper, more distracting sensation. Warm play applied to fully engorged tissue produces a deeper, more diffuse pleasurable warmth. Temperature play works best from a foundation of established arousal.

Partner Temperature Play: Communication and Sequence

For partnered temperature play, the person receiving temperature sensation should have control over the pacing either by directing the giving partner explicitly or through a clear communication signal to pause or adjust. Temperature sensation is more variable between individuals than most other sensation types: what is pleasantly warm for one person is too hot for another at the same objective temperature. Communication before and during partnered temperature play is not optional it is what makes the difference between an amplified arousal experience and an uncomfortable one.

Suggested partnered temperature play sequence: external warmth first (the giving partner using warmed hands or a warmed external object on non-genital erogenous areas), progressing to external genital warmth, then internal warm stimulation after the receiving partner has confirmed that each temperature level is comfortable.

For cool play in a partner context: brief cool contrast on external areas only until the receiving partner's comfort with the sensation is clearly established. Internal cool stimulation should be introduced only after significant comfort with external cool sensations is confirmed across multiple sessions.

Temperature Play Safety: The Complete Framework

Safe Temperature Ranges

Application Minimum Safe Temperature Maximum Safe Temperature
External genital skin 10°C / 50°F 42°C / 107.6°F
Internal vaginal use 15°C / 59°F 40°C / 104°F
Internal anal use 15°C / 59°F 39°C / 102.2°F

Always Test Before Internal Use

Test any warmed or cooled product on the inner wrist for at least 30 seconds before any genital or internal contact. If the temperature is comfortable on the wrist, it is within the external genital range. Genital and internal mucosa can be slightly more sensitive than the wrist use the wrist test as confirmation of safe range, not as evidence that maximum temperature has been reached.

Signs to Stop Immediately

Stop temperature play immediately and assess for injury if: any burning or stinging sensation develops during warm play, any numbness or persistent aching develops during cold play, any redness that does not resolve within 30 minutes of ending temperature play, or any tissue changes are visible after a session.

Minor temporary flushing from warm play that resolves within minutes is normal. Pain is not.
